The Kobeissi Letter: US job openings are now at recession levels:
US job openings dropped -386,000 in December, to 6.5 million, the lowest since September 2020. Over the last 2 months, job openings have declined -907,000, the biggest 2-month drop since March 2023.

It's still kind of a mystery how hunter-gatherers and Europe's first farmers dealt with each other. But in this instance, the discovery of a 7,500-year-old deer skull headdress and tools made from antlers suggests that the hunter-gatherers were sharing ideas and technologies with farmers. 🏺🧪🦌
7,500-year-old deer skull headdress discovered in Germany indicates hunter-gatherers shared sacred items and ideas with region's first farmers
The discovery of a deer skull headdress and tools made from antlers at the site of a New Stone Age farming village suggests that hunter-gathers were sharing ideas with the newcomers.

A carpal bone from the right forefoot of an elephant at the site of Colina de los Quemados, identified with the Iberian oppidum of Corduba,has yielded a radiocarbon dating between the 4th and 3rd centuries BCE.
The find’s context is intimately linked to the events of the Second Punic War in Hispania
Archaeologists find evidence of Hannibal's war elephants in Spain
A small bone discovered in southern Spain may represent the first direct archaeological evidence of the war elephants used by Hannibal Barca during the Punic Wars. - HeritageDaily - Archaeology News
